Types of Car Repairs and Finding the Right Auto Mechanic

Vehicle owners need to manage different kinds of repair needs, all of which demand specialized skills and understanding. Common repairs include transmission work, electrical system repairs, brake services, and engine diagnostics. Engine diagnostic services focus on pinpointing problems using sophisticated equipment, while brake services focus on guaranteeing optimal safety and performance. Transmission servicing is often complicated, typically demanding highly trained technicians, and electrical system maintenance tackles concerns involving circuits and associated components.

When looking for an auto mechanic, it is important to keep in mind the kind of repair needed. Auto mechanics frequently have areas of specialization, making it essential for car owners to pair their car's unique needs with the right mechanic's knowledge. Furthermore, understanding of the car's make and model can improve the overall repair experience. By understanding the types of repairs and finding the right auto mechanic, car owners can ensure their cars get the proper attention, leading to improved reliability and a longer vehicle lifespan.

What to Look For in a Reliable Auto Mechanic

When looking for a reliable auto mechanic, how does one determine the right decision is being made? Essential elements to assess include certifications, experience, and customer reviews. A reputable mechanic often holds credentials from reputable organizations, showing they have received adequate training and comply with industry standards. Moreover, experience holds significant importance; a mechanic with several years in the field tends to have a more comprehensive knowledge of various vehicle models and issues.

Customer testimonials provide valuable insights into a mechanic's dependability and service standards. Favorable reviews and strong ratings can suggest a trustworthy professional. Additionally, honest pricing and effective communication are important characteristics. A dependable mechanic should give comprehensive quotes and outline repairs in plain language. Finally, a solid warranty on parts and labor can demonstrate pride in their craftsmanship, giving the car owner reassurance.

How to Research Local Mechanics Effectively

What are the best ways to research local relevant information mechanics to ensure a smart decision? First, utilizing online resources is essential. Websites like Yelp and Google Reviews provide customer feedback and ratings, giving insights into mechanics' reputations. Additionally, social media platforms can help identify local options and highlight community recommendations.

One more powerful strategy entails asking friends or family for referrals, as personal experiences often yield trustworthy suggestions. Checking out local automotive forums can also be highly advantageous, where passionate community members exchange their insights and suggestions.

When a handful of potential mechanics have been found, checking for certifications and affiliations with professional organizations, including the Automotive Service Association (ASA), can boost confidence in their expertise. Finally, visiting the shops in person allows for evaluating cleanliness, organization, and customer service, which further guides the decision-making process. Performing detailed research helps individuals identify a mechanic who aligns with their needs and expectations.

Benefits of Preventive Maintenance

Consistent preventive maintenance can significantly extend a vehicle's service life and enhance its performance. Scheduled inspections and timely maintenance, such as oil changes and tire rotations, help identify potential issues before they develop into costly repairs. This forward-thinking approach not only cuts expenses but also guarantees that the vehicle operates efficiently, boosting fuel efficiency and minimizing emissions. Additionally, adhering to a scheduled maintenance plan can preserve the manufacturer's warranty, providing additional peace of mind. A consistently maintained vehicle is also safer, as preventive checks can address critical components like steering and brakes. Overall, consistent maintenance fosters reliability and elevates the driving experience, making it critical for vehicle owners to focus on these services.

What Warranties Do Auto Repair Shops Typically Offer?

Auto repair facilities generally offer warranties covering both parts and labor, which can range from 30 days to multiple years. Coverage varies by shop, so clients are encouraged to ask about the specific terms and conditions prior to approving any repairs.

What Signs Should I Be Aware of Before Taking My Car to a Mechanic?

Before visiting a mechanic, one should watch for strange sounds, alert lights, fluid drips, decreased performance, or unusual vibrations. These signs indicate underlying problems that call for professional inspection to ensure your vehicle remains safe and dependable.

How Frequently Should I Get My Car Serviced?

The majority of experts suggest having a vehicle serviced every 5,000 to 7,500 miles, or at least twice a year. Consistent servicing helps secure peak performance, enhances safety, and extends the life of the vehicle, making it a necessity for vehicle owners.
